Virginia Postrel
The elements that create glamour are not specific styles — bias-cut gowns or lacquered furniture — but more general qualities: grace, mystery, transcendence. To the right audience, Halle Berry is more glamorous commanding the elements as Storm in the X-Men movies than she is walking the red carpet in a designer gown.
